
Spearheaded by the ‘very personable and knowledgeable’ Roger Potgieter in Birmingham, the TLT team has vast expertise in financial services disputes, ranging from negligent advice to misrepresentation claims. Potgieter is highly knowledgeable in contentious recoveries and is a go-to adviser for banks and leasing companies, while Julie Peel chiefly concentrates on fraudulent transactions. Amanda Wootton and Turon Miah are also recommended.
